- BMCFAHC ; IHS/PHXAO/TMJ - PRINT REFERRAL FORM ;
- ;;4.0;REFERRED CARE INFO SYSTEM;;JAN 09, 2006
- ;
- ;
- START ;
- W:$D(IOF) @IOF
- W "********** ARIZONA HEALTH CARE COST CONTAINMENT SYSTEM FORM PRINT **********",!!
- W "This report will produce a hard copy computer generated AHCCCS form.",!!
- GETREF ;get referral entry
- S BMCREF=""
- S DIC="^BMCREF(",DIC(0)="AEMQ",DIC("A")="Select Referral by Patient Name, date of referral or referral #: " D ^DIC K DA,DIC
- G:Y=-1 XIT
- S BMCREF=+Y
- ZIS ;
- W !! S XBRC="COMP^BMCFAHC",XBRP="PRINT^BMCFAHC1",XBNS="BMC",XBRX="XIT^BMCFAHC"
- D ^XBDBQUE
- Q
- XIT ;
- K BMCREF,BMCCHSR,BMCCMT
- Q
- COMP ;
- S BMCFTYPE=2
- Q
- BMCFAHC ; IHS/PHXAO/TMJ - PRINT REFERRAL FORM ;
- +1 ;;4.0;REFERRED CARE INFO SYSTEM;;JAN 09, 2006
- +2 ;
- +3 ;
- START ;
- +1 IF $DATA(IOF)
- WRITE @IOF
- +2 WRITE "********** ARIZONA HEALTH CARE COST CONTAINMENT SYSTEM FORM PRINT **********",!!
- +3 WRITE "This report will produce a hard copy computer generated AHCCCS form.",!!
- GETREF ;get referral entry
- +1 SET BMCREF=""
- +2 SET DIC="^BMCREF("
- SET DIC(0)="AEMQ"
- SET DIC("A")="Select Referral by Patient Name, date of referral or referral #: "
- DO ^DIC
- KILL DA,DIC
- +3 IF Y=-1
- GOTO XIT
- +4 SET BMCREF=+Y
- ZIS ;
- +1 WRITE !!
- SET XBRC="COMP^BMCFAHC"
- SET XBRP="PRINT^BMCFAHC1"
- SET XBNS="BMC"
- SET XBRX="XIT^BMCFAHC"
- +2 DO ^XBDBQUE
- +3 QUIT
- XIT ;
- +1 KILL BMCREF,BMCCHSR,BMCCMT
- +2 QUIT
- COMP ;
- +1 SET BMCFTYPE=2
- +2 QUIT